ocr基础入门到毕业1.背景最近为了实现读取图片文字,在网上也是各种查询资料,下载软件,遇到各种坑,总结一下相关资源下载:2.安装注意: 安装版本推荐3.05。 路过的坑1:tesseract-ocr-setup-3.02.02:在文字库合并的时候,会导致合并后字库识别出来都是空的。1.双击运行“tesseract-ocr-setup-3.02.02.exe”tesseract ocr 中文版开始
这是一个photoshop面板插件,我练手的,本插件完全开源,不加密,用户可以学习了解HTML面板的运作流程。插件目前实现文字识别和二维码识别,如果需要识别其他类型,可以参考百度AI。插件下载:一个photoshop CEP插件OCR文字识别OCR采用的百度AI OCR识别node.js接口APP_ID = 17594920 API_KEY = puMFv72xqCYV2jdcSlXgtFvm
OCROCR(optical character recognition),光学字符识别。      OCR文字识别是指电子设备(例如扫描仪或数码相机)检查纸上打印的字符,然后用字符识别方法将形状翻译成计算机文字的过程;即,对文本资料进行扫描,然后对图像文件进行分析处理,获取文字及版面信息的过程。       如何除错或利用辅助信息提高识
在游戏中如何来使用LUA是本文要介绍的内容,主要是来学习游戏中lua的使用方法,具体内容的实现来看本文详解。首先,让我来简单的解释一下Lua解释器的工作机制,Lua解释器自身维护一个运行时栈,通过这个运行时栈,Lua解释器向主机程序传递参数,所以我们可以这样来得到一个脚本变量的值:获取脚本的变量的值lua_pushstring(L, "var"); //将变量的名字放入栈 lua_gettatbl
前言这些其实都是初级程序员面临的困境,当你提高自身能力,登上更高的层级之后,无论薪资还是发展都会有很大的提升。那么问题来了,怎么才能度过初级程序员的瓶颈,进阶成为高薪工程师呢?在学习和使用 ngx_lua 的过程中我们发现,网络上资料其实非常多,但是非常零散,没有整体性,虽然技术本身是很清晰和易用的,但是对于刚接触这门技术的开发者来说,想要有条理、系统地把这些知识学完,可能会走一些弯路。因为很多资
转载 2024-08-27 12:24:19
99阅读
想一想你之前如何将线下收集的材料信息采录到线上系统的?比如作为财务人员,员工凭发票报销费用,但是收集到发票录入信息是需要将发票种类名称、发票代码、纳税人识别号等各种信息录入到系统。你是不是还在一个字母一个字母敲击键盘录入?是不是不止一次抱怨过这样效率太低?不仅如此,如果一下子有几百张发票需要处理,是不是录到怀疑人生? 轻流现在就能满足你的愿望!本次更新的轻流OCR功能,可立刻实现对图像
# OCRJava的项目方案 ## 引言 OCR(Optical Character Recognition,光学字符识别)是一种通过扫描文字图像并将其转换为可编辑和搜索的电子文本的技术。在现实世界中,OCR应用广泛,如护照识别、银行支票处理和汽车号牌识别等。本文将介绍如何使用Java编写一个OCR项目,并提供示例代码。 ## 项目需求 我们的OCR项目需要实现以下功能: 1. 从图像中识别
原创 2023-10-18 13:49:09
142阅读
以下示例来自Ubuntu17.10(1)安装tesseractsudo apt-get install tesseract-ocr(2)如果想用 Tesseract 对图像进行识别,还需要对应的语言文件。所谓的语言文件是 Tesseract 识别某种语言的文字图像时需要的一些资源,这些东西也可以通过包管理器获取。sudo apt-get install tesseract-ocr-eng tess
 一、到官网去下载。我下的是kindeditor-3.5.5-zh_CN.zip,当前比较稳定的版本。 二、解压之后,把它拷到你的项目的 WebRoot下。当然不是所有东西都有用,我拷的是下面几个: commons-fileupload-1.2.1.jar commons-io-1.4.jar json_simple-1.
转载 2023-11-16 14:08:22
57阅读
前言  一般在我们开发项目的时候经常会更新数据库表的字段,如果同事 a 添加了表字段,没有及时给同事 b sql 脚本,  可能同事 b 的代码运行就会报错,而且随着时间的推移,sql 脚本越来越多,项目上线的时候整理起来就很费时间  所以就有大佬级别的人物创造了 Flyway 这个数据库版本管理工具。环境JDK 1.8.0 +Maven 3.0
感谢1303冯康宇同学制作并提供样例 观看样例点这里 1、显示网络(视图->网格),打开网格吸附(视图->贴紧->贴紧至网格),在舞台下方设置帧频为30fps2、执行:插入->新建元件,名称:zxxw,类型:按钮,确定,选择文本工具,在下面的属性面板中设置:字体为黑体、大小为20、颜色为蓝色(第九行第二列),在舞台上添加文本:最新新闻,并相对于舞台居中3
# Python实现抽签 ## 1. 概述 在这篇文章中,我将向你介绍如何使用Python编写一个简单的抽签程序。抽签是一种随机选择的过程,常见于各种活动和游戏中。我们将使用Python中的随机数生成库来实现这个功能。 ## 2. 实现步骤 下面是整个实现过程的流程图: ```mermaid journey title 抽签程序 section 初始化 开始 --> 生
原创 2023-09-30 10:51:10
194阅读
在vue中使用wow.js如果不按照以下方法实施,会出现意想不到的BUG,网页刷新后图片就全部突然看不到了,被增加了一个隐藏属性,建议大家严格按照方法执行,不要随意使用(1)通过npm安装:npm install wowjs --save-devanimate.css会自动安装。(2)在main.js中引入animate.cssimport 'animate.css'在组件需要的地方引入wowjs
Paddle OCR Win 11下的安装和简单使用教程对于中文的识别,可以考虑直接使用Paddle OCR,识别准确率和部署都相对比较方便。环境搭建目前PaddlePaddle 发布到v2.4,先下载paddlepaddle,再下载paddleocr。根据自己设备操作系统进行下载安装。paddle官网地址:https://www.paddlepaddle.org.cnpip install pa
转载 2024-02-06 14:47:08
198阅读
码字流程获取微信的PID连接到微信微信的一些基本功能获取用户发来的消息获取聊天信息用户在聊天界面找到某个用户搜索某个用户向某个户发送文本信息删除某个用户微信的一些额外功能修改备注添加指定申请好友一键添加所有申请好友发送图片至指定用户接收超级用户指令,处理相关任务接收普通用户指令,回复相关内容一键删除所有好友掉线通知超级用户掉线自动重登对接其他接口,完成相关任务收藏信息自动收款判断金额并通知超级
lua元表metatable理解metatable设置方法:以下实例演示了如何对指定的表设置元表:__index元方法总结__newindex 元方法__call 元方法定义元方法__call 最近总是遇到如果通过脚本语言搭建一个OOP结构,于是针对Lua进行了解,发现需要用到其元表metatable来实现,则对Lua的metatable进行一个理解的整理 理解: 名称:元表,本身也是一个ta
C++中冒号(:)和双冒号(::)的用法 1.冒号(:)用法(1) 表示结构体(Struct)内位域的定义(即该变量占几个bit空间)typedef struct _XXX { unsigned char a : 4; unsigned char c; }; XXX (2)构造函数后面的冒号起分割作用,是类给成员变量赋值的方法,初始化列表,更适用于成员变量的常量
随着做软件的时间越来越长,我发现,做软件越来越难。难在哪?难在怎么做出一个好的软件。好的软件标准是什么?两个词,好用,好看!程序员的最大价值在于做出好用又好看的软件的能力。因此,我觉得程序员的价值绝对不在于技术本身,而在于做出好用且好看软件的能力。这是一个开放性的话题,每一个人都是菜鸟过来的,我希望和祝愿每一个技术人员都能尽快成为高手,也希望更多老鸟来分享经验。在这篇文章,我将根据自己的经验来分享
否有过这样的经历,在网上发现一篇好文,却没办法复制,怎么办?手动抄录吗,我想如果没有OCR,大部分人会这么做。OCR是一种图像处理技术,又叫文字识别,能够将图像中不可复制的文字转换成可编辑的文字形式,简单来说,用户对无法复制的文本进行拍照,通过文档识别软件进行识别,即可获得可编辑、可保存的电子文档信息。工作生活中,经常会遇到档案录入、纸质信息读取、客户名片资料存储等工作,如果单纯使用人工去录入信息
lv_fontfont的声明在lv_font.h中,lvgl自带了很多大小字库就是在这里声明,比如#define LV_FONT_DECLARE(font_name) extern lv_font_t font_name; #if LV_FONT_MONTSERRAT_8 LV_FONT_DECLARE(lv_font_montserrat_8) #endif其中LV_FONT_MONTSERRA
  • 1
  • 2
  • 3
  • 4
  • 5